TURN-208: Gatevale turnstile counters at the Merrow Field pilot double-count when a rotation reverses mid-cycle. Attendance totals drift roughly 2% high per event. The debounce window fix is implemented, reviewed by Ilsa, and soak-tested across two simulated match days without drift. Ready for your cut; the candidate build is identified below.

trace token, tagag-tafog: htk6_5ed18c

FD leak hunt on the Quillbox workers. First, grab the lsof snapshot script from the ops repo and run it against the stuck process — if the count keeps climbing, it's the usual culprit: the Marrowpipe upload client not closing streams. To reproduce locally you'll need the staging env file filled in. The Marrowpipe service token belongs on the line below.

env line for fafof-fahag: LEDGER_TOKEN5=f8790

The garage occupancy feed for the Brindlewood campus arrives over a message queue every thirty seconds, one record per level, published by the Stallgrid edge boxes. Counts can briefly go negative when a sensor double-fires on exit; the ingest job clamps these to zero and flags the interval. If the feed stalls for more than five minutes, the dashboard falls back to the last known snapshot. Sensor mappings, queue names, and the replay procedure are documented on the internal page below.

runbook for tahog-kadug: https://gitlab.qirvanworks.corp/projects/pages/view/b139298aed28